    The deliberate inclusion of real-life stress factors like time pressure, limited resources, and unexpected challenges in mock exercises is crucial. It prepares participants for the unpredictable nature of actual disasters, helping them develop resilience and adaptability under duress. This realism is what transforms theoretical knowledge into practical, crisis-ready skills, making the training highly effective.
